Possible Prospects


For my research paper on the stereotyping of all Asians being smart I’ve already gotten two interviews setup. One interviewee is a friend of mine whose mother is Asian. Nonetheless, the interviewee herself does not have any physical features of an Asian. I have another friend who is from the Philippines but is frequently referred to as Asian by other people. I am also planning on interviewing my TA for Pre-Calculus. Although I’m not sure if she is Asian or from the Philippines, she has the physical characters that fits both cultures. I want to interview someone who believes in this stereotype to find why is they think it to be true.

Each of these individuals will bring add a new aspect to my research. My first interviewee brings diversity to my research for she is African American with an Asian mother. My second interviewee brings up the question, does anyone who look Asian also considered in the all “Asians are smart stereotype?”
